LSE has earned a reputation for academic excellence, and as such, has a plethora of incredible study spots throughout its campus. While each location has its unique advantages, I have found three that stand out as my personal favourites.

  1. Firstly, the most obvious study spot on campus is the LSE Library. I won’t say that this is the most enjoyable place to study on campus, but I will say it’s the place where I make the most progress with my studies. This is because, there are specific floors and areas designated as “silent areas”. This type of peace and quiet, respected by everyone who chooses to study there, can make you focus during even the most unmotivated times. For this reason, I had to include the library, and more specifically the silent areas, on my list.
  2. Next, when it comes to group study sessions or collaborative projects, I prefer locations with a bit more vibrancy. The Cheng Kin Ku Building fits the bill perfectly. Specifically, the eighth floor boasts study rooms with floor-to-ceiling windows that provide stunning panoramic views of the LSE campus and the surrounding area. I have found that having such a great view elevates everyone’s mood and provides the ideal environment for creative and collaborative work. Plus, if you need a quick break – you can actually step outside on the balcony to take in the scenery with some fresh air.
  3. The last study area that I’d recommend is the most social. Take advantage of the student lounges available in each department, where you can connect with peers from different cohorts, engage in lively discussions about class topics (which counts as studying!), and get some reading done in between classes. These vibrant spaces offer the perfect balance of study and socialising, allowing you to unwind and recharge in good company before diving back into your academic pursuits.
